12 set 2003 ano - SA Government Finally Accepts HIV/AIDS FACTS

Descrição:

Two long accepted facts across the globe: that HIV causes AIDS, and that anti-retroviral drugs can retard the progress of the disease, are for the record, at last acceded to by the South African government.
‘Personally, I don't know anybody who has died of AIDS', President Thabo Mbeki tells The Washington Post.
Also according to the Washington Post, South Africa is one of the countries most affected by HIV and AIDS. About 4.7 million people ( ±11 % of the population) are infected with the virus. Between 600 and 1,000 die each day from the disease and related complications
